Есть несколько движков для ускорения DDX. "UXA" (Архитектура Единого Ускорения) является зрелой базовой, которая была введена для поддержки модели драйвера GEM. Именно в процессе заменены "SNA" (новое ускорение в SandyBridge). Cпособность выбора использовать базовую остается для обратной совместимости.
SNA — стандартный метод ускорения в xf86-video-intel. Если вы наблюдаете проблемы с SNA, попробуйте переключить на UXA. Для этого нужно создать файл конфигурации X со следующим содержимым: Section "Device" Identifier "Intel Graphics" Driver "intel" Option "AccelMethod" "uxa" EndSection
В Ubuntu по умолчанию уже установлен драйвер видеокарт Intel. Он содержится в пакете xserver-xorg-video-intel.
Обновление драйвера
Обновление из PPA
Этот репозиторий содержит разрабатываемую версию драйвера. В случае неправильной работы драйвера вы можете вернуться к стандартным драйверам при помощи утилиты ppa-purge.
Для обновления до последней версии драйвера xserver-video-intel можно воспользоваться готовым PPA. Открыть терминал и ввести следующие команды:
В Ubuntu по умолчанию уже установлен драйвер видеокарт Intel. Он содержится в пакете xserver-xorg-video-intel.
Обновление драйвера
Обновление из PPA
Этот репозиторий содержит разрабатываемую версию драйвера. В случае неправильной работы драйвера вы можете вернуться к стандартным драйверам при помощи утилиты ppa-purge.
Для обновления до последней версии драйвера xserver-video-intel можно воспользоваться готовым PPA. Открыть терминал и ввести следующие команды:
Вписать в /etc/X11/xorg.conf (подправить существующий, либо создать пустой, если нет). Ну и быть готовым, что при ошибочной конфигурации графическая оболочка может не запуститься, перейти по Ctrl+Alt+F1 и править до рабочего состояния через консоль.
Параметры системы -> Экран -> Обеспечение эффектов, поэкспериментируйте с параметром Движок (только имейте в виду, что XRender - программный, на нем часть эффектов отключится).
Параметры системы -> Поведение рабочей среды -> Рабочая среда, попробуйте отключить "Показывать всплывающие подсказки", попробуйте на вкладке "Эффекты" по одному отключать, скорее всего, артефакты дает какой-то один или комбинация двух-трех на определенном железе.
Дело не в самом железе, а в проявлении. Определенное железо + определенная версия драйвера + определенная версия Qt + совмещение двух-трех эффектов = проявление бага. Наиболее вероятно, что баг в дровах.
Драйвер на видео поставь. Параметры системы, диспетчер драйверов. И будет счастье :)
Дак драйвер стоит. А счастье нет. Параметры системы, диспетчер драйверов вообще показывает что все хорошо.
Покажите вывод
lspci -v
glxinfo | grep OpenGL
Если нет glxinfo, установите
sudo apt-get install mesa-utils
lspci -v
00:00.0 Host bridge: Intel Corporation 3rd Gen Core processor DRAM Controller (rev 09)
Subsystem: Lenovo Device 3977
Flags: bus master, fast devsel, latency 0
Capabilities: <access denied>
Kernel driver in use: ivb_uncore
00:02.0 VGA compatible controller: Intel Corporation 3rd Gen Core processor Graphics Controller (rev 09) (prog-if 00 [VGA controller])
Subsystem: Lenovo Device 3977
Flags: bus master, fast devsel, latency 0, IRQ 25
Memory at e0000000 (64-bit, non-prefetchable) [size=4M]
Memory at d0000000 (64-bit, prefetchable) [size=256M]
I/O ports at 3000 [size=64]
Expansion ROM at <unassigned> [disabled]
Capabilities: <access denied>
Kernel driver in use: i915
00:16.0 Communication controller: Intel Corporation 7 Series/C210 Series Chipset Family MEI Controller #1 (rev 04)
Subsystem: Lenovo Device 3977
Flags: bus master, fast devsel, latency 0, IRQ 26
Memory at e0604000 (64-bit, non-prefetchable) [size=16]
Capabilities: <access denied>
Kernel driver in use: mei_me
00:1a.0 USB controller: Intel Corporation 7 Series/C210 Series Chipset Family USB Enhanced Host Controller #2 (rev 04) (prog-if 20 [EHCI])
Subsystem: Lenovo Device 3977
Flags: bus master, medium devsel, latency 0, IRQ 16
Memory at e0609000 (32-bit, non-prefetchable) [size=1K]
Capabilities: <access denied>
Kernel driver in use: ehci-pci
00:1b.0 Audio device: Intel Corporation 7 Series/C210 Series Chipset Family High Definition Audio Controller (rev 04)
Subsystem: Lenovo Device 3977
Flags: bus master, fast devsel, latency 0, IRQ 27
Memory at e0600000 (64-bit, non-prefetchable) [size=16K]
Capabilities: <access denied>
Kernel driver in use: snd_hda_intel
00:1c.0 PCI bridge: Intel Corporation 7 Series/C210 Series Chipset Family PCI Express Root Port 1 (rev c4)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0, IRQ 17
Bus: primary=00, secondary=01, subordinate=01, sec-latency=0
I/O behind bridge: 00002000-00002fff
Memory behind bridge: e0500000-e05fffff
Capabilities: <access denied>
Kernel driver in use: pcieport
00:1c.1 PCI bridge: Intel Corporation 7 Series/C210 Series Chipset Family PCI Express Root Port 2 (rev c4)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0, IRQ 16
Bus: primary=00, secondary=02, subordinate=02, sec-latency=0
Memory behind bridge: e0400000-e04fffff
Capabilities: <access denied>
Kernel driver in use: pcieport
00:1d.0 USB controller: Intel Corporation 7 Series/C210 Series Chipset Family USB Enhanced Host Controller #1 (rev 04) (prog-if 20 [EHCI])
Subsystem: Lenovo Device 3977
Flags: bus master, medium devsel, latency 0, IRQ 23
Memory at e0608000 (32-bit, non-prefetchable) [size=1K]
Capabilities: <access denied>
Kernel driver in use: ehci-pci
00:1f.0 ISA bridge: Intel Corporation 7 Series Chipset Family LPC Controller (rev 04)
Subsystem: Lenovo Device 3977
Flags: bus master, medium devsel, latency 0
Capabilities: <access denied>
Kernel driver in use: lpc_ich
00:1f.2 SATA controller: Intel Corporation 7 Series Chipset Family 6-port SATA Controller [AHCI mode] (rev 04) (prog-if 01 [AHCI 1.0])
Subsystem: Lenovo Device 3977
Flags: bus master, 66MHz, medium devsel, latency 0, IRQ 24
I/O ports at 3088 [size=8]
I/O ports at 3094 [size=4]
I/O ports at 3080 [size=8]
I/O ports at 3090 [size=4]
I/O ports at 3060 [size=32]
Memory at e0607000 (32-bit, non-prefetchable) [size=2K]
Capabilities: <access denied>
Kernel driver in use: ahci
00:1f.3 SMBus: Intel Corporation 7 Series/C210 Series Chipset Family SMBus Controller (rev 04)
Subsystem: Lenovo Device 3977
Flags: medium devsel, IRQ 10
Memory at e0605000 (64-bit, non-prefetchable) [size=256]
I/O ports at 3040 [size=32]
01:00.0 Ethernet controller: Qualcomm Atheros QCA8172 Fast Ethernet (rev 10)
Subsystem: Lenovo Device 3802
Flags: bus master, fast devsel, latency 0, IRQ 28
Memory at e0500000 (64-bit, non-prefetchable) [size=256K]
I/O ports at 2000 [size=128]
Capabilities: <access denied>
Kernel driver in use: alx
02:00.0 Network controller: Broadcom Corporation BCM43142 802.11b/g/n (rev 01)
Subsystem: Lenovo Device 0611
Flags: bus master, fast devsel, latency 0, IRQ 17
Memory at e0400000 (64-bit, non-prefetchable) [size=32K]
Capabilities: <access denied>
Kernel driver in use: wl
glxinfo | grep OpenGL
OpenGL vendor string: Intel Open Source Technology Center
OpenGL renderer string: Mesa DRI Intel(R) Ivybridge Mobile
OpenGL core profile version string: 3.3 (Core Profile) Mesa 11.0.2
OpenGL core profile shading language version string: 3.30
OpenGL core profile context flags: (none)
OpenGL core profile profile mask: core profile
OpenGL core profile extensions:
OpenGL version string: 3.0 Mesa 11.0.2
OpenGL shading language version string: 1.30
OpenGL context flags: (none)
OpenGL extensions:
OpenGL ES profile version string: OpenGL ES 3.0 Mesa 11.0.2
OpenGL ES profile shading language version string: OpenGL ES GLSL ES 3.00
OpenGL ES profile extensions:
С драйвером все хорошо, работает.
Section "Device"
Identifier "Intel Graphics"
Driver "intel"
Option "AccelMethod" "uxa"
EndSection
help.ubuntu.ru
Цитата:
В Ubuntu по умолчанию уже установлен драйвер видеокарт Intel. Он содержится в пакете xserver-xorg-video-intel.
Обновление драйвера
Обновление из PPA
Этот репозиторий содержит разрабатываемую версию драйвера. В случае неправильной работы драйвера вы можете вернуться к стандартным драйверам при помощи утилиты ppa-purge.
Для обновления до последней версии драйвера xserver-video-intel можно воспользоваться готовым PPA. Открыть терминал и ввести следующие команды:
sudo add-apt-repository ppa:oibaf/graphics-drivers
Обновить список пакетов:
sudo apt-get update
Теперь, обновить систему:
sudo apt-get dist-upgrade
Перезагрузить компьютер.
Цитата:
В Ubuntu по умолчанию уже установлен драйвер видеокарт Intel. Он содержится в пакете xserver-xorg-video-intel.
Обновление драйвера
Обновление из PPA
Этот репозиторий содержит разрабатываемую версию драйвера. В случае неправильной работы драйвера вы можете вернуться к стандартным драйверам при помощи утилиты ppa-purge.
Для обновления до последней версии драйвера xserver-video-intel можно воспользоваться готовым PPA. Открыть терминал и ввести следующие команды:
sudo add-apt-repository ppa:oibaf/graphics-drivers
Обновить список пакетов:
sudo apt-get update
Теперь, обновить систему:
sudo apt-get dist-upgrade
Перезагрузить компьютер.
Не помогло. Но спасибо.
Lenovo g500 это не очем не говорит.
Их там огромное количество конфигураций.
Хотя бы вкратце характеристики напишите.
Процессор: 2*Intel Celeron CPU 1005M 1.9 GHz
Видео: Intel HD Graphics 3000
Операивная память: 4 Гб
Жесткий диск: 300 ГБ
MacLeod не понял ка мне это сделать.
Вписать в /etc/X11/xorg.conf (подправить существующий, либо создать пустой, если нет). Ну и быть готовым, что при ошибочной конфигурации графическая оболочка может не запуститься, перейти по Ctrl+Alt+F1 и править до рабочего состояния через консоль.
MacLeod не помогло.
Параметры системы -> Экран -> Обеспечение эффектов, поэкспериментируйте с параметром Движок (только имейте в виду, что XRender - программный, на нем часть эффектов отключится).
Параметры системы -> Поведение рабочей среды -> Рабочая среда, попробуйте отключить "Показывать всплывающие подсказки", попробуйте на вкладке "Эффекты" по одному отключать, скорее всего, артефакты дает какой-то один или комбинация двух-трех на определенном железе.
По экспериментирую, но я не думаю, что дело в железе на openSUSE таких проблем не было.
Дело не в самом железе, а в проявлении. Определенное железо + определенная версия драйвера + определенная версия Qt + совмещение двух-трех эффектов = проявление бага. Наиболее вероятно, что баг в дровах.
Отправить комментарий